Abstract
A divide-by-4 injection-locked frequency divider (ILFD) is realized in a 90 nm CMOS process. By using the coupled inductors, the locking range of the proposed divide-by-4 ILFD is enhanced. This ILFD has a measured locking range of 125.7-131.9 GHz. Its power consumption is 3.6 mW for a supply of 1.2 V. To the authors' best knowledge, this is the first CMOS divide-by-4 ILFD operated over 130 GHz.
